David Cuberes is a Professor in the Department of Economics at Maynooth University's Faculty of Social Sciences. His research spans urban economics, economic history, and economic growth, focusing on city development, gender inequality impacts, and demographic transitions. Based in Rhetoric House, Room 1, Floor Top, he teaches and conducts research while maintaining a personal website.
His research explores:
- Urbanization processes across countries
- Conflicts' effects on population dynamics
- Household location determinants
- Aggregate impacts of gender disparities
- Democracy-growth volatility links
- Demographic transition mechanisms
Recent publications address labor market gender gaps in Malaysia, New England growth patterns, and entrepreneurship disparities. He has previously worked at Clemson University, Royal Holloway, Universidad de Alicante, University of Sheffield, and Clark University. Professional collaborations include the World Bank, IMF, and Inter-American Development Bank.
His academic journey began with undergraduate studies at Universitat Pompeu Fabra, followed by a Master's in Economics and Finance at CEMFI and a PhD in Economics at the University of Chicago.
